Top 3 Best Dade County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 4 public schools serving 2,025 students in Dade County, GA.
The top ranked public schools in Dade County, GA are Davis Elementary School, Dade Elementary School and Dade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Dade County, GA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 41% (versus the Georgia public school average of 35%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 39% statewide average). Schools in Dade County have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Georgia public schools.
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Georgia public school average of 63% (majority Black).
